What Does Passed Mean At A Car Auction

Passed Vehicles means the reserve on the car was not met.
All the cars are all good running cars that we guarantee the motor and transmission is in good working order or you get your money back. This over course adds value and forces companies to bring us good running cars. That is good news for you.
Because these cars are actually bought for real money there is a actual price attached to the cars. This is called a Wholesale reserve. Like all auctions in the world auctions do not actually own what they are auctioning off, banks own them typically. As a result we do not know the exact price of this reserve, but being in business for over 10 years we know that a wholesale price reserve averages out to about 50% of the Kelly blue book retail value.
So as long as you are within that range, 50% of the Kelly blue book retail value, you are going to win the car for the lowest for a wholesale price in the USA.
For example, if you are looking at a 2002 Jeep Cherokee and the Blue Book retail is $6825 you should be prepared to bid around $3500.
A few times a year we have what is called a No Reserve Blowout Auction. These very special Auctions are rare in that they are the exception to this rule. And with good reason because the car sells to the high bidder no matter what! During those auctions Many Cars are Sold under No Reserve and still have a good motor guarantee. Those cars will be clearly marked NO RESERVE in the heading next to the car in our online catalog.

The Car Auction Question of the Week Comes From Sam

hi my name is sam and im very curious about your auction ive been lookin for one for quite awhile but have question, if i come to your auction and dont find a vehicle that day do i still have to pay a fee?? and can i test drive vehicle before i buy?? if you could email me back as asap so i kno and i could ocme down wed. thank you for your time,

Thanks for your interest Sam,

I am glad to inform you we do not charge you to attend our auction. You will not have to pay a fee if you do not win a car or bid on a car or even test drive our cars! Test Drives are 9am-5pm on Wednesdays.
